Understanding Door Handle Mechanisms
Before diving into repair alternatives, it's important to comprehend the types of door handles and their mechanisms. Here's a quick overview:
Type of Door HandleDescriptionCommon IssuesLever HandleA handle that you lower to open the door.Loose fittings, misalignment.Knob HandleA round knob that you twist to open.Stuck mechanisms, broken knobs.Push and Pull HandleTypically found on sliding doors; pushed or pulled.Use and tear gradually.Digital HandleKeyless entry with a keypad or biometric.Battery issues, electronic faults.Common Issues with Door Handles
Here are some common issues residential or commercial property owners confront with door handles:
Loose Handles: Often triggered by screws that have come loose or worn-out elements.Stuck Handles: Frequently due to collected dirt, rust, or used mechanisms.Broken Parts: Components like springs or latches can break, rendering the handle unusable.Misalignment: This takes place when the door handle repair professional is not hung properly, triggering the handle to not work efficiently.Visual Damage: Scratches, dents, or rust can impact the appearance, specifically in high-traffic locations.The Local Door Handle Repair Process

Just how much does it typically cost to repair a door handle?
The cost of repair differs based upon the complexity of the problem, the type of handle, and local labor rates. Typically, repairs can range from ₤ 50 to ₤ 150.
2. Can I fix a loose handle myself?
Yes, many fix loose door handle handles can be tightened with a screwdriver. Nevertheless, if the problem persists, it's advisable to look for professional help.
3. The length of time does a typical door handle repair take?
Most repairs can be finished within a couple of hours. Larger tasks or those requiring part replacements might take longer.
4. What should I do if my handle is stuck?
Try cleansing around the handle and applying lubricant. If that doesn't work, seek advice from a professional to avoid further damage.
5. Are there preventative procedures I can take?
Frequently inspect your door handles, tighten screws, and lubricate moving parts to lower wear and tear.
